The Role
As a Unit Supervisor, you will be responsible for ensuring our customers have a great time when they visit us! You will be driven, passionate, and have a natural ability to create a fun environment for both our customers and team. You will:
- Manage day-to-day operations, ensuring excellent customer service and adherence to policies and procedures.
- Promote a sales-focused culture and identify sales opportunities within the centre.
- Lead and support team development and growth, deputizing in the absence of senior management.
- Interpret and implement Tenpin's corporate strategy and core values, setting and achieving short-term objectives.
Skills You Need
- At least 12 months of supervisory experience in leisure, hospitality, or retail.
- Passionate about exceptional customer service.
- Experienced in leading large teams.
- Determined, enthusiastic, and patient.
- Ambitious and eager to progress.
- Fully flexible and adaptable to change.
